
Ingredients
- 200 g Pizza dough
- 80 g Tomato sauce
- 30 g Zucchini, grated
- 50 g Broccoli, blanched or frozen
- 20 g Green asparagus, blanched
- 90 g Oldenburger Mozzarella, coarsely grated
- Dried oregano
Instructions

Preparation
Roll out the dough in a round shape about 25 cm in diameter, brush with tomato sauce and spread 60 g of Oldenburger Mozzarella on top. Then distribute the zucchini, broccoli and green asparagus and spread another 30 g of Oldenburger Mozzarella on top. Season with oregano and bake in an oven preheated to 330°C for about six minutes.Tips from Chefs to Chefs
After baking, dribble some olive oil onto the pizza.
